Senior Commercial Banking Analyst – National Full-Time Permanent About Us First Nations Bank of Canada is a federally chartered bank primarily focused on providing financial services to the Indigenous marketplace in Canada. Being 90% Indigenous owned and controlled, FNBC is a leader in advocating for the growth of the Indigenous economy and the economic well-being of Indigenous people. Headquartered in Saskatoon, SK and named one of Saskatchewan’s Top Employers 2026, FNBC takes pride in its workforce of over 61% Indigenous employees working at locations across Canada. About The Roles As a Senior Commercial Banking Analyst – National, you will provide analytical and credit support to the National Business Development team. You will assist Commercial Credit Underwriters in managing customer risk, preparing high-quality credit applications, conducting financial analysis, and developing competitive lending solutions that meet customer needs while adhering to Bank policies and procedures. This is a permanent full-time opportunity at our Saskatoon branch. About You You are a highly analytical and motivated professional who thrives in a fast-paced environment. You are detail-oriented, organized, and committed to delivering high-quality work while building strong relationships with internal stakeholders. You are adaptable, eager to learn, and capable of managing multiple priorities and deadlines. Key Responsibilities: * Analyze financial statements, business plans, valuations, and Confidential Information Memorandums (CIMs) * Structure and package competitive financing solutions for commercial clients * Prepare credit applications with strong risk assessment, due diligence, and credit presentation * Support Commercial Credit Underwriters with credit adjudication and portfolio management * Identify business growth opportunities within existing customer relationships * Apply pricing models and concepts to maximize profitability and meet pricing thresholds * Monitor portfolios and support timely renewals of commercial credits * Ensure compliance with Bank policies, procedures, and industry codes of conduct * Provide recommendations on credit decisions to the Manager of Business Development You Must: * Have post-secondary education in Business (BComm, BAdmin, or equivalent) * Have 2-5 years of experience in business lending, financial analysis, commercial banking, or a related field * Demonstrate strong financial analysis and credit writing skills * Be proficient with Microsoft Copilot, Excel, and Word * Possess excellent communication, organizational, and time management skills * Have the ability to prioritize work, meet deadlines, and adapt to changing priorities * Demonstrate professionalism, initiative, and a strong desire to learn and grow We are passionate about creating an inclusive workplace and value and respect diversity of our staff.
